USAID: Climate Adaptation Activity (Dominican Republic and Haiti)

Gender-Responsive Climate Finance Window

Deadline: 03-Aug-2023

The United States Agency for International Development (USAID) is seeking applications for a Cooperative Agreement from qualified entities to implement the Climate Adaptation Activity.

The United States Agency for International Development in the Dominican Republic’s (USAID/DR) resilience interventions including the Climate Adaptation Activity are planned as part of USAID/DR’s Border Resilience Project under USAID/DR’s 2020-2025 Country Development Cooperation Strategy (CDCS).

This Activity targets the DR-Haiti northern border provinces of Santiago Rodríguez, Montecristi, and Dajabón which are home to important transboundary watersheds that supply water for human consumption, irrigation, and industrial use for towns on both sides of the border. These provinces have seen the highest increase in population density and city growth relative to other provinces in the region.
